    Ryder Cup Crowd Chant Sparks Backlash: “This Is Why We’re Losing to Europe

    Sports media reacts to embarrassing Ryder Cup crowd chant: ‘This is why we’re losing to Europe’ – Awful Announcing
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email Copy Link Tumblr Reddit VKontakte Telegram WhatsApp

    In the wake of a controversial crowd chant at the recent Ryder Cup, sports media outlets have sharply criticized the display, with some commentators blaming fan behavior for the United States’ disappointing performance against Europe. The chant, widely deemed inappropriate and embarrassing, has sparked a broader conversation about sportsmanship and the role of audience conduct in international competitions. This reaction highlights ongoing frustrations as Team USA continues to grapple with a series of losses on the global golf stage.

    Analysis of How Fan Conduct Influences Player Performance and International Competitiveness

    Fan behavior during high-stakes sports events extends far beyond mere noise-making; it actively shapes the psychological landscape for competing athletes. A hostile or disrespectful crowd chant can erode players’ concentration,confidence,and overall mental resilience. In the recent Ryder Cup incident, the cringe-worthy chant not only undermined team spirit but also portrayed a lack of sportsmanship that detracts from the players’ focus. Such distractions can amplify performance pressure, causing athletes to falter during critical moments, which cumulatively impacts the outcome of individual matches and, ultimately, the international competitiveness of the team.

    Moreover, these negative fan conduct moments often reverberate beyond the event itself, influencing perceptions and reputations on a global scale. European players have frequently emphasized how a supportive and respectful audience enhances their performance, fostering an environment where skill can flourish unimpeded. Contrastingly, displays of poor crowd behavior contribute to a hostile, anxiety-ridden atmosphere detrimental to home team morale.The table below summarizes key ways fan conduct interacts with player performance and competitiveness:

    Experts Call for Enhanced Crowd Management and Fan Education at Major Sporting Events

    In the wake of the Ryder Cup’s controversial crowd behavior, experts in sports event management are urging organizers to implement more robust crowd control strategies. The improper chanting and disruptive atmosphere not only undermined the event’s integrity but also spotlighted notable gaps in current fan regulation protocols. Specialists suggest integrating advanced monitoring technologies combined with increased steward presence to swiftly address and diffuse unruly incidents before they escalate. Clear behavioral codes and visible enforcement could help maintain a respectful environment conducive to the spirit of fair play.

    Alongside stricter controls, there is a growing call for comprehensive fan education campaigns aimed at promoting sportsmanship and respect among attendees. Engaging fans early through pre-event communications and on-site messaging can foster a sense of shared responsibility. Suggested initiatives include:

    • Interactive workshops or digital content illustrating acceptable crowd conduct
    • Incentivized participation in positive cheering programs
    • Collaboration with player ambassadors to model respectful behavior

    A coordinated approach combining enforcement and education is seen as critical to preventing future disruptions and preserving the event’s prestige on the global stage.
